We currently have a OD-AD Triangle set up. We are having an issue with the Dock preferences for users. We are specifying in WGM exactly the icons we want to show up in the student docks. This is working. Except, behind the icons we've specified the students are still getting a few icons that that we have not specified (that I suppose the local machines are putting there). How can we avoid this and only have the icons we specify in WGM show up?

Hi

 

De-select the 'Merge with User's Dock' option. Leaving this selected means network users who log in get the local admin account's dock setting as well.

 

The other possibility is the preference is being managed at different levels? For example a set of applications defined for the Dock at Group Level as well as Computer Level. If there is an application(s) defined at one level and a different application(s) at the other then these will combine and/or accumulate. If the Dock Setting allows Safari for the Group but denies it for the Computer the Computer setting will override the Group.

 

Unlike AD the order of Preferences are User, Computer, Group.
